Starting Game 3 Pham (hand) is starting in left field and batting fifth in Game 3 of the NL Wild Card Series against the Cardinals on Friday.
Impact The 32-year-old has been dealing with sporadic pain in his left hand since returning from surgery in mid-September, but it won't prevent him from starting Friday's winner-take-all contest. Pham is on a tear through the first two games of the series, going 6-for-9 with two doubles, one run, one RBI and one stolen base.

Expected to play Friday Manager Jayce Tingler said following Thursday's win that he expects Pham (hand) to be able to play in Game 3 of the NL Wild Card Series against the Cardinals on Friday, 97.3 The F...
Impact Tingler said that Pham has been battling through sporadic pain in his left hand after returning from hamate bone surgery in mid-September. He noted that it's not an issue that can get worse, so as long as Pham can continue to withstand the pain, he will remain in the lineup for the Friars going forward.

Appears to aggravate hand Pham appeared to aggravate his surgically repaired left hand in Thursday's game against St. Louis, Dennis Lin of The Athletic reports.
Impact Jurickson Profar took over in left field in the ninth after Pham appeared to irritate his hand during the bottom of the eighth. Pham was sidelined for a month after undergoing surgery to repair the hamate bone in his left hand in mid-August, so it's very possible his removal Thursday is related to the previous injury. Further update from the Padres should be provided following the tilt.

Hits homer Saturday Pham went 1-for-4 with a two-run home run in Saturday's win over the Giants.
Impact It has been a difficult first season in San Diego for Pham, who missed much of the campaign with a fractured bone in his left hand and is slashing a disappointing .219/.322/.324. However, he could be an important component if the Padres are to go deep into the postseason, and he built some momentum heading toward the playoffs with his two-run shot in the ninth inning Saturday. The homer was Pham's third of the campaign.

Takes seat Sunday Pham is out of the lineup for Sunday's game against the Mariners.
Impact After a month-long stay on the 10-day injured list due to a fractured hand, Pham returned to action as the Padres' designated hitter over the past two games, going 2-for-7 with a walk between those two contests. Though Eric Hosmer will serve as the Padres' DH in the series finale, Pham should serve as the primary option at that lineup spot during the final week of the regular season.

Reaches base twice in return Pham went 1-for-3 with a walk and a run in a win over the Mariners on Friday.
Impact Pham was reinstated from the injured list prior to the contest and slotted into the sixth spot in the order as the team's DH. He drew a walk in his first plate appearance and later scored the Padres' second run after leading off the fourth frame with a single. Pham figures to use the final week of the campaign to shake off any rust due to his recent hand surgery in order to gear up for the playoffs. He's slashing .212/.323/.294 with six stolen bases in 24 games this season.

Placed on injured list Pham (hand) was placed on the 10-day injured list Monday.
Impact Pham was diagnosed with a fracture in the hamate bone on his right hand Monday, so it's no surprise to see him land on the injured list. He's expected to miss 4-to-6 weeks as a result of the injury, but it's possible that could return at the end of the regular season if the Padres are in playoff contention. Infielder Ty France was recalled in a corresponding move. Jurickson Profar, Edward Olivares and Jorge Mateo could see increases in playing time while Pham is sidelined.

Out with fractured hand Padres manager Jayce Tingler told Jim Duquette of Sirius XM Radio on Monday that Pham fractured the hamate bone in his right hand during Sunday's 5-4 loss to the Diamondbacks.
Impact Though the skipper didn't offer specifics on Pham's next steps, the 32-year-old will head to the injured list and will almost certainly require surgery to repair the broken bone. Once surgery is completed, the Padres should offer a clearer timeline for Pham's recovery, but he'll likely be sidelined for multiple weeks and could very well be shut down for the season. Josh Naylor was recalled from the Padres' alternate site ahead of Sunday's game and could be a candidate to fill Pham's spot in the everyday lineup. Edward Olivares and Jorge Mateo could also benefited from added opportunities sans Pham.

Leaves game with numb hand Pham left Sunday's game with numbness in his right hand, Judson Richards of XTRA1360 reports.
Impact Pham was pulled from Sunday's loss to the Diamondbacks in the middle of an at-bat in the ninth inning after fouling a ball off. Manager Jayce Tingler said after the game that he was dealing with a numb right hand. The 32-year-old is expected to be examined Sunday and Monday, after which a better idea of the severity should become clear. Pham also left Saturday's game with cramping in his calves but was able to serve as the designated hitter Sunday.
